         <title>Introductory Research Assignment</title>
         <author>abby_rouse</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/abby_rouse/cgt4iiapzg/wish/20807172</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Students will explore the history of the Salem Witch Trials in order to better prepare for the reading assignment.&nbsp; Research will revolve around essential questions:</p><p>1. When it happened</p><p>2. Where it happened</p><p>3. What circumstances contributed to the hysteria</p><p>4. What the trials were like</p><p>5. One specific case associated with the trials</p><p>6. What led to the sudden end</p>]]></description>

         <title>Introduction</title>
         <author>abby_rouse</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/abby_rouse/cgt4iiapzg/wish/20807602</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>The Crucible, written by the great American playwright, Arthur Miller, is commonly studied in high school Language Arts classrooms.&nbsp; While the play is filled with history, scandal and questions of morality--making it a high interest read for many students--the text is fairly complicated in its rich inclusion of multiple historical events.&nbsp; The play largely serves as social commentary; therefore it is important the students understand the play on multiple levels.&nbsp; </p><p>This page provides links to resources meant to assist in instruction as well as several assignment ideas, act quizzes, and video.</p>]]></description>
